Political Quotes

On the recordOctober 16, 1960
I believe that every American, regardless of their race, their creed, or their color is entitled not only to vote, but to hold office in our country.
Said by
John Fitzgerald Kennedy
Democratic · Massachusetts

Editor's note · Context

Speech of Senator John F. Kennedy, Wittenberg College Stadium, Springfield, Ohio
